Police blow down door after domestic disturbance escalates
DAVENPORT, Iowa (KWQC) - A portion of West Locust Street was shut down by police after reports of gunfire and police blew open a door on the house on Wednesday night.
Davenport police said officers arrived at a home for a domestic disturbance with gunfire in the 900 block of West Locust at 10:24 p.m. Wednesday. The Emergency Services Team was called in to execute a search warrant, and officers were seen on the street around 11:30 p.m. with armor.
Around 12:30 a.m. on Thursday, KWQC saw police blow the home’s door open.
Police said it was a domestic disturbance that escalated and a single shot was fired. No injuries or property damage were reported by the bullet.
Police said they are investigating, but as of Thursday morning no arrest had been made.
